Step-by-Step Guide to Connecting Your Domain to Your Website

Creating a website is an essential step for any business or individual looking to establish an online presence. One of the key components of setting up a website is connecting your domain to your website. This process can seem daunting at first, but with the right guidance, it can be a straightforward and seamless task. In this article, we will provide you with a step-by-step guide to connecting your domain to your website, specifically focusing on Wix website optimization.

Step 1: Choose a Domain Provider
Before you can connect your domain to your website, you need to have a domain name. There are many domain providers to choose from, such as GoDaddy, Namecheap, or Google Domains. Once you have purchased your domain, you will need to log in to your domain provider’s website to access your domain settings.

Step 2: Access Your Domain Settings
In your domain provider’s dashboard, look for the option to manage your domain settings. This is where you will find the DNS (Domain Name System) settings that you will need to update to connect your domain to your website.

Step 3: Update Your DNS Settings
In the DNS settings, you will need to add a CNAME (Canonical Name) record and an A (Address) record to point your domain to your website. For Wix website optimization, you will need to add the following records:

– CNAME Record: Enter “www” in the Name field and “www.yourdomain.com” in the Value field.
– A Record: Enter “@” in the Name field and the IP address provided by Wix in the Value field.

Step 4: Verify Your Domain Connection
After updating your DNS settings, you will need to verify that your domain is connected to your website. You can do this by entering your domain name in a web browser and checking if your website loads correctly. If your website does not load, double-check your DNS settings and make sure they are correct.

Step 5: Set Up SSL Certificate
To ensure that your website is secure, you will need to set up an SSL (Secure Sockets Layer) certificate for your domain. This will encrypt the data transmitted between your website and your visitors, providing a secure browsing experience.
